  Job Summary

  Summary: Operates linen room functions and distributes clean linen throughout facility as scheduled.

  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  Delivers clean linen to the different departments within the hospitals.

  Picks up all soiled carts from all floors if working on the second shift.

  Takes and fills orders from hospital staff.

  Ensures all exchange carts are delivered to the floors.

  Ensures all soil linen has been picked up and taken to the receiving dock.

  Ensures all soil carts are full; if not full, plans for consolidation.

  Reports issues or concerns to supervisor immediately.

  Ensures that linen room is left neat and organized at the end of the shift.

  Builds clean, neat, organized carts to set standard par level.

  Cleans linen room as necessary—sweep, mop, pick-up as necessary.

  Opens new linen for processing.

  Aligns/stages carts as needed.

  Performs other duties as assigned.

  Qualifications:

  Ability to lift 50 pounds and push/pull a wheeled cart of 650 pounds.

  Ability to count and record inventory of terry/linen.

  Must have excellent problem solving and customer service skills.

  Ability to work in a fast paced health care environment.
